You don't need this as a base. Just make a mod that overrides 06_ep3_admin_decisions.txt with your own copy with modified AI rules. Alternatively, make a separate file with an identical AI-only decision and modified AI rules if you want to minimise mod conflicts. I don't know how to mod the AI behaviour itself yet though.

That isn't tied to government, its tied to dynasties and cultures. If the founder of your starting house is from a culture with that tag, then your title name and CoA will always be that of your house. But you can disable dynasty named titles for the whole map in the game settings. You could also try starting a cadet branch with a ruler of a culture without that tag, but I don't know if that actually works.
